The first Georgia Peach festival was staged in Fort Valley in 1986. Officially incorporated in 1988 as the Georgia Peach Festival, Inc., the festival was once directed by the Chamber of Commerce. Today a volunteer board plans, organizes and executes the complex job of putting on the festival.

The idea of a Peach Festival was conceived by Harold Peavy to promote Peach County and the peach industry that has contributed so much to the livelihood of the state of Georgia. Georgia ranks third in the nation in the annual production of peaches, with more than 15,000 acres of peach trees yielding more than 1.7 million bushels of peaches annually. More than half of that harvest is cultivated in Peach County alone.

The purpose of the Peach Festival is to honor peach growers for their contribution to our state's economy and to the food industry nationwide. This 2007 Georgia Peach Festival commemorates the event's 21st anniversary and the 83rd anniversary of Peach County! The Peach Festival holds the honor of being the only state–sanctioned food festival.

The Georgia Peach Festival is partially funded by government partners such as the Peach County Board of Commissioners, Fort Valley Utility Commission, the City Governments of Byron and Fort Valley, the Byron Convention and Visitors Bureau and the Peach County tourism committee. In addition, funds are donated by local and regional businesses. Certain annual events staged prior or during the Peach Festival, produce revenue. These events include arts and crafts vendor fees, 5k race fees, golf tournament fees and local celebrity dinner fees. The sale of tee-shirts and festival-franchised merchandise also adds to the festival's income.
